➔ All jobs
➔ Jobs at Podaris
➔ Apply for this job
TL;DR- A role with serious impact and autonomy to help build our transportation planning platform.
- A company with a purpose: Podaris was founded in the belief that better transportation planning tools can create a better world.
- Endless opportunities to solve complex algorithmic challenges, from graph routing problems, to algebraic geometric constraint solvers.
- A truly flexible environment: set your own hours, your own remote location, and directly influence tools and technologies used.
- £50k-£60k with a meaningful equity component.
Podaris is a fast-growing startup in the transport and urban planning sector, aiming to change the way the world plans its cities. Our mission is to bring together all stakeholders in the urban development process -- planners, engineers, transport technology vendors, public interest groups, property developers, and more -- in a shared modelling environment, where ideas can be iterated in a rapid and agile fashion. We have created a web-based collaborative transport planning platform which incorporates aspects of GIS, CAD, transport simulation, and more.
The platform is being used by customers around the world, from large-multinational private campus owners, to global consultancies, to local authorities and transport operators. They use Podaris for everything from bus network redesigns, to the planning of new innovative multi-billion pound fixed-infrastructure schemes.
Our small team makes for an inclusive, interdisciplinary, and intellectually stimulating environment. We value diversity and welcome candidates from non-traditional backgrounds. The UK/US-based team has been working remotely since before the pandemic.
About the jobWe’re looking for a fullstack engineer to join our growing team. You'll be able to make a big impact, joining a small but very enthusiastic team. Our platform is centred around a feature-rich collaborative single-page application, that is built using technologies such as Openlayers, Node.js, MongoDB, and Meteor.js. Our stack includes a number of other programming languages and frameworks used throughout different services, and your experience with those is less important than your expertise with modern Javascript.
Specific responsibilities
Developing and implementing new features for our javascript-heavy single page application.
- Solving algorithmic problems in areas such as computational geometry, parametric constraint solvers, and transport network routing.
- Monitoring and improving the performance and usability of the platform.
- Collaborating with the wider team to debug issues and support customers using the platform.
- Contributing to the end-to-end lifecycle of features, from concept to UI to deployment to metrics to support.
Essential
- Excellent in-depth knowledge of Javascript.
- A thorough understanding of web technologies (HTML, CSS, Javascript) and experience with frameworks such as Meteor.js to build single-page applications.
- A strong understanding and experience of modern development practices (agile methodologies, git, continuous integration, bug/issue tracking).
- Willingness to learn new skills - we want people who are happy to get involved in almost any part of the stack if required.
- A good understanding of design patterns and software engineering principles.
- Self-motivated with a strong sense of ownership. You understand that startups are unpredictable environments and are comfortable with a degree of chaos.
Desirable
- Previous experience using Meteor.js
- Experience with transport data formats such as OpenStreetMap, GTFS and TransXchange.
- Familiarity with transport design/planning/engineering tools such as CAD and GIS.
- Experience working in a fast-paced, high growth, technology-focused organisation.
- Interest in system architecture, and experience with event-driven approaches for asynchronous task processing and data pipelines.
- Knowledge of Kubernetes, Docker, and other CloudNative technologies.
- Rare opportunity to join a fast-growing and dynamic mobility software startup.
- £50k-£60k with a meaningful equity component.
- Flexible location and hours (most of our team is UK-based, so we would require a strong overlap).
- Remote-first autonomous team.
- As a small team, we can consider putting in place other benefits if important to you - please ask!
Categories
- Top JavaScript Jobs Worldwide
- Junior JavaScript Jobs Worldwide
- Mid-weight JavaScript Jobs Worldwide
- Senior JavaScript Jobs Worldwide
- Front End Jobs Worldwide
- Senior Front End Jobs Worldwide
- Junior Front End Jobs Worldwide
- Full Stack Jobs Worldwide
- Senior Full Stack Jobs Worldwide
- React Jobs Worldwide
- Senior React Jobs Worldwide
- React Native Jobs Worldwide
- TypeScript Jobs Worldwide
- Node.js Jobs Worldwide
- Back End Jobs Worldwide
- Angular Jobs Worldwide
- Vue.js Jobs Worldwide
Locations
- North America
- South America
- Europe
- Africa
- Asia
- Oceania
- United States
- San Francisco, USA
- Los Angeles, USA
- New York, USA
- Austin, USA
- Miami, USA
- Seattle, USA
- Chicago, USA
- Canada
- European Union
- United Kingdom
- London, UK
- Spain
- Barcelona, Spain
- Madrid, Spain
- Portugal
- Lisbon, Portugal
- Porto, Portugal
- France
- Paris, France
- Italy
- Rome, Italy
- Milan, Italy
- Germany
- Berlin, Germany
- Frankfurt, Germany
- Australia
- Sydney, Australia
- Melbourne, Australia
- Belgium
- Brussels, Belgium
- Czechia
- Prague, Czechia
- Brno, Czechia
Collections
- Aerospace companies
- Automotive companies
- Blockchain companies
- Creative companies
- Cryptocurrency companies
- Data companies
- Developer Tools companies
- Finance companies
- Fashion companies
- Gaming companies
- Healthcare companies
- Human Resources companies
- Marketing companies
- Media companies
- Metaverse companies
- Music companies
- NFT companies
- No-Code companies
- Non-Profit organisations
- Productivity companies
- Real Estate companies
- Retail companies
- Robotics companies
- SaaS companies
- Security companies
- Social Media companies
- Software companies
- Sports companies
- Sustainability companies
- Tech-for-Good companies
- Telecomunication companies
- Transportation companies
- Travel companies
- Jobs providing visa sponsorship
- 4 day week jobs